Shut-In Communion Ministry exists to provide communion and fellowship to
those who are in the hospital, nursing home facilities, or are homebound.
Ministry Needs:
Homebound Communion Delivery: Two or three more couples/individuals who are willing to deliver communion on a rotating schedule. The leaders prepare the communion box each week for the volunteers.
All volunteers have to do is pick up the box in the communion room at church. There will be a list in the box that contains a list of addresses/phone numbers of those who need communion delivery on that particular week. Volunteers simply deliver and serve communion to each individual on the list, taking time to fellowship with each person. Fellowship is a big part of this ministry; Sometimes the volunteers may be the only ones these individuals see regularly.
The boxes are returned to the communion room the following Sunday.
